Output 73b59eb90f249ec76f2f19d5ebfd1a28bf5b44361a3ef34ac1bf2713b4c8b35e:2

value
19809807
script pubkey
OP_0 OP_PUSHBYTES_20 7f2507f4a7e6ee389c5f313e827e6ad4053a8238
address
bc1q0ujs0a98umhr38zlxylgyln26szn4q3cza9xur
transaction
73b59eb90f249ec76f2f19d5ebfd1a28bf5b44361a3ef34ac1bf2713b4c8b35e